Participants will learn to:

Enhance bone strength through safe dynamic weight bearing movement and resistance.

Improve posture and cultivate a reliable anti-gravity axis.

Coordinate natural patterns of movement that minimize compressive forces on the spine.

Use neuro-motor strategies for assuring the safety of vulnerable joints.

Create springy pulsations of pressure that promote bone health.

Increase ability to go up and down stairs with ease and comfort. 

Improve dynamic equilibrium, stability, and the ability to fall “well”.

Reduce stiffness, aches and pains and restore the joy of movement.

Maximize function, vitality, and quality of life with aging.

Deborah Elizabeth Lotus, GCFP ; Certified Bones for Life® Trainer,  trained with originator Ruthy Alon at Kripalu Center  (2001-4). Deborah first trained personally with Moshe Feldenkrais, D.Sc.,  beginning at Esalen Institute in 1972, continuing in the First Professional Feldenkrais® Training Program in S.F. in the mid-‘70s, ultimately graduating during the second professional Amherst Training in 1981. She was among the first designated Pioneer BFL Trainers in North America in 2004.  She has taught both the Feldenkrais® Method and Bones for Life Classes at Harvard University’s “Center for Wellness and Health Communication”; Wellspace, the Arlington Center,  was Guest Faculty/Trainer at Lesley University’s professional BFL Training in 2005. She is committed to the concept of team-teaching and with four other Feldenkrais and BFL colleagues has recently formed Cambridge Feldenkrais® Associates in Harvard Square.  Deborah has spent extensive time in Africa, traveling, teaching and observing cultural/primal movement patterns in dance, ritual and daily life.
